Kwakye is a traditional Akan male name from Ghana meaning 'born on Wednesday.' It originates from the Akan people who name children based on the day of the week they are born, linking them to spiritual and cultural traits. The name is etymologically tied to 'Kwaku' with the suffix '-ye' denoting masculine identity in some dialects.

Cultural Significance of Kwakye

The name Kwakye is deeply rooted in Akan culture, where day names carry spiritual meanings and traits believed to influence personality. Being born on Wednesday, Kwakye is linked to creativity, communication, and adaptability. This practice is integral to Akan identity and preserves ancestral heritage through naming conventions handed down for centuries.
